Exploring Different Types of Flag Poles

Flag poles come in a variety of materials, including aluminum, fiberglass, and wood. Each material has its own unique characteristics and advantages. Aluminum poles, for example, are lightweight and durable, making them an excellent choice for areas with strong winds. Fiberglass poles are also lightweight but offer more flexibility and resistance to corrosion. Wood poles, on the other hand, add a rustic and classic touch to any garden but may require more maintenance over time.

Upgrade Your Bathroom Bathtub Drain Replacement Essentials

Upgrade Your Bathroom with Bathtub Drain Replacement

Essential Preparations

Before diving into bathtub drain replacement, it’s crucial to prepare adequately. Start by gathering the necessary tools and materials, including a drain wrench, pliers, plumber’s putty, and a new drain assembly. Additionally, clear out any clutter around the bathtub area to provide ample workspace. Finally, familiarize yourself with the specific instructions for your bathtub model to ensure a smooth replacement process.

Assessing the Situation

Once you’re ready to begin, the first step is to assess the condition of your bathtub drain. Determine whether the drain is simply clogged and requires cleaning or if it’s damaged and in need of replacement. If the drain is severely corroded, cracked, or leaking, replacement is likely the best course of action to prevent further damage to your plumbing system.

Removing the Old Drain

Removing the old bathtub drain can be a challenging task, especially if it’s been in place for many years. Start by using a drain wrench or pliers to loosen the drain fitting and remove it from the bathtub. You may need to apply some force or use penetrating oil to loosen stubborn fittings. Once the drain is removed, clean the surrounding area thoroughly to ensure a proper seal with the new drain assembly.

Installing the New Drain

With the old drain removed, it’s time to install the new drain assembly. Begin by applying plumber’s putty to the underside of the drain flange to create a watertight seal. Then, insert the drain into the drain hole and tighten it securely using a drain wrench or pliers. Be careful not to overtighten, as this can damage the drain or cause leaks. Once the drain is in place, wipe away any excess putty and test the seal by running water into the bathtub.

Testing and Troubleshooting

After installing the new bathtub drain, it’s essential to test it thoroughly to ensure it’s functioning correctly. Fill the bathtub with water and check for any signs of leaks around the drain assembly. If you notice any leaks, try tightening the fittings slightly or reapplying plumber’s putty to create a better seal. Additionally, check the drain for proper drainage and address any clogs or blockages as needed.

Finishing Touches

Once you’re satisfied with the installation of the new bathtub drain, it’s time to add the finishing touches to your bathroom. Clean up any debris or excess putty around the drain area, and replace any fixtures or accessories that were removed during the installation process. Finally, give your bathtub a thorough cleaning to remove any remaining residue and ensure it’s sparkling clean and ready for use.

Maintaining Your New Drain

To prolong the life of your new bathtub drain, it’s essential to practice regular maintenance. Keep the drain clean and free of debris by using a drain strainer or stopper to prevent hair, soap scum, and other particles from entering the drain. Additionally, periodically inspect the drain for signs of leaks or damage and address any issues promptly to prevent costly repairs down the line.

Prevent Frozen Pipes Essential Winter Plumbing Tips

Winter Plumbing Woes: Unfreezing Your Pipes

Winter can be a magical time, with snow-covered landscapes and cozy nights by the fire. However, it also brings its fair share of challenges, especially when it comes to plumbing. One of the most common issues homeowners face during the colder months is frozen pipes. When temperatures drop below freezing, the water inside pipes can solidify, causing them to expand and potentially burst. This article will explore effective strategies for unfreezing pipes and preventing costly damage to your home.

Understanding the Problem

Before diving into solutions, it’s essential to understand why pipes freeze in the first place. When water inside a pipe reaches the freezing point, it begins to expand, putting pressure on the walls of the pipe. If the pressure becomes too great, the pipe can burst, leading to water damage and costly repairs. Pipes located in unheated or poorly insulated areas of the home, such as attics, crawl spaces, or exterior walls, are particularly susceptible to freezing.

Identifying Frozen Pipes

The first step in addressing frozen pipes is identifying which ones are affected. Signs of frozen pipes include no water coming from faucets, strange odors from drains, or visible frost on exposed pipes. If you suspect a pipe is frozen, it’s essential to act quickly to prevent further damage.

Thawing Techniques

Several techniques can be used to thaw frozen pipes safely. One method is to apply heat directly to the affected area using a hairdryer, heat lamp, or electric heating pad. It’s crucial to start at the end of the pipe nearest to the faucet and work your way toward the blockage slowly. Never use an open flame to thaw pipes, as this can create a fire hazard.

Another effective method is to wrap the frozen pipe in towels soaked in hot water or use an electric heating tape designed for this purpose. This gentle heat can gradually thaw the ice inside the pipe without causing damage. Additionally, turning up the thermostat in your home can help raise the temperature of the affected area and encourage thawing.

Preventive Measures

Preventing frozen pipes is always preferable to dealing with the aftermath. There are several steps homeowners can take to minimize the risk of frozen pipes during the winter months. Insulating exposed pipes with foam pipe insulation can help protect them from freezing temperatures. Pay special attention to pipes in unheated areas of the home, such as basements, attics, and crawl spaces.

It’s also essential to keep your home heated properly during the winter months. Maintaining a consistent temperature, even when you’re away, can help prevent pipes from freezing. Opening cabinet doors to allow warm air to circulate around pipes located under sinks can also be beneficial.

In extremely cold weather, allowing faucets to drip slightly can help prevent pipes from freezing. The movement of water through the pipes can help prevent ice from forming. However, this should only be done as a last resort and may not be necessary if your pipes are adequately insulated.

Seeking Professional Help

In some cases, thawing frozen pipes may require the expertise of a professional plumber. If you’re unable to locate the frozen area or if attempts to thaw the pipe are unsuccessful, it’s essential to call in a professional. A licensed plumber will have the tools and experience necessary to safely thaw the pipes and address any underlying issues.

Average Cost for Kitchen Remodel Tips and Insights

Understanding the Average Cost of Kitchen Remodel

Planning Your Budget

When it comes to remodeling your kitchen, one of the most crucial aspects to consider is your budget. Understanding the average cost of a kitchen remodel is essential for effective planning. Before diving into the renovation process, it’s important to assess your financial situation and determine how much you’re willing to invest in your kitchen transformation.

Factors Affecting Cost

Several factors influence the cost of a kitchen remodel. The size of your kitchen, the quality of materials chosen, and the extent of the renovation all play significant roles in determining the final price tag. Additionally, factors such as labor costs, permits, and unexpected expenses can impact your overall budget. By identifying these factors early on, you can better prepare for potential costs and avoid surprises along the way.

Average Cost Breakdown

On average, a kitchen remodel can cost anywhere from $10,000 to $50,000 or more, depending on various factors. A minor remodel, which may include cosmetic updates like painting cabinets and replacing hardware, typically falls on the lower end of the price spectrum. On the other hand, a major renovation involving structural changes, custom cabinetry, and high-end appliances can drive costs up significantly. It’s essential to consider your specific needs and preferences when budgeting for your remodel.

Setting Realistic Expectations

While it’s natural to want your dream kitchen, it’s important to set realistic expectations based on your budget. Prioritize your must-haves and be prepared to make compromises where necessary. Consider alternative materials or layouts that offer similar aesthetics at a lower cost. By being flexible and open-minded, you can achieve a beautiful and functional kitchen that aligns with your financial constraints.

Cost-Saving Strategies

There are several strategies you can employ to save money on your kitchen remodel without sacrificing quality. For instance, opting for stock cabinets instead of custom ones can significantly reduce costs. Similarly, choosing laminate countertops over quartz or granite can provide substantial savings without compromising style. Additionally, tackling some of the renovation work yourself, such as painting or demolition, can help cut down on labor expenses.

Budgeting for Contingencies

No matter how meticulously you plan your kitchen remodel, it’s essential to budget for contingencies. Unexpected issues, such as plumbing or electrical problems, can arise during the renovation process, leading to additional costs. Aim to set aside at least 10-20% of your total budget for unforeseen expenses. Having a financial buffer in place will provide peace of mind and ensure that you’re prepared to handle any surprises that may arise.
